1. Slim-Tuk (Kydex IWB)
The Slim-Tuk is one of DeSantis' most popular IWB holster options for a reason. Built from precision-molded Kydex, this minimalist pistol holster keeps a low profile against your body while covering the full trigger guard. Its ambidextrous design means one holster works for both left and right-handed shooters.
What sets the Slim-Tuk apart is the tuck-able 360 C-Clip, which gives you unlimited mounting positions along your waistband. You can carry in the appendix position, at 3 o'clock, or behind the hip without swapping hardware. 2. Thumb Break Scabbard (Leather OWB)
The Thumb Break Scabbard is a staple in the DeSantis catalog. This OWB leather holster positions your 1911 at a high ride height with an optimum draw angle. The thumb break provides an active retention device that keeps your pistol locked in place until you're ready to draw, while exact molding and an adjustable tension device add a second layer of security.
This holster accommodates belts up to 1 3/4" wide and offers excellent concealment for an OWB design. It's a favorite among law enforcement professionals and civilians who prefer the confidence of a thumb break without sacrificing draw speed.

4. Speed Scabbard (Leather OWB)
The Speed Scabbard takes the thumb break out of the equation for faster presentations. This OWB leather holster was originally designed for plainclothes professionals who needed quick access to their firearm without the extra step of releasing a retention strap.
Retention comes from precise molding and an adjustable tension device, giving you a secure passive retention holster that still allows a fast, clean draw. It fits belts up to 1 3/4" wide and positions your 1911 at a natural draw angle that promotes a smooth, consistent presentation.

How to Choose the Right 1911 Holster
Picking the best holster for your 1911 comes down to a few key factors:
- Carry position: IWB holsters like the Slim-Tuk and Cozy Partner offer better concealment. OWB options like the Thumb Break Scabbard and Speed Scabbard provide more comfort and faster access.
- Material: Leather conforms to your body over time and looks classic. Kydex holds its shape from day one and handles moisture well. Nylon offers a lightweight, affordable alternative.
- Retention style: Active retention (thumb break) adds security. Passive retention (friction and molding) prioritizes draw speed. Your personal preference and carry context should guide this choice.
- Fitment: DeSantis offers 1911 holsters sized for all standard models between 3” and 5” barrels. Make sure you're selecting the right compatibility for your specific pistol.
